A crucial insight often missed by outsiders: Indonesia is not a single language market. While Bahasa Indonesia is the national language, TikTok’s algorithm has resurrected regional languages for profit.

A creator speaking refined Jawa Halus (High Javanese) in a video about tahu sumedang (fried tofu) will see higher engagement in West Java than a national celebrity using standard Indonesian. The platform thus re-tribalizes the nation, creating parallel video ecologies that never cross-feed.

As of 2026, the Indonesian entertainment landscape is experiencing a massive transformation, driven by a surge in high-quality local cinema, a digital-first creator economy, and a growing presence on global streaming platforms. With over 229 million internet users and a median age of just 30, Indonesia has become Southeast Asia's largest and most vibrant digital market. The Golden Era of Indonesian Cinema

The film industry is currently shifting from high-volume production to "quality economics," with box office admissions projected to reach 100 million annually by the end of 2026. Local content has become the dominant force in domestic theaters, capturing roughly 65% of the total box office share. Popular Hits of 2025-2026:

The streaming market in Indonesia has reached a milestone where local productions now equal Korean programming in viewership share, with both holding roughly 30% each. Platforms like Vidio

, Viu, and Netflix are heavily investing in "Originals" that resonate with local sensibilities. Top-performing series in 2025 include Losmen Bu Broto: The Series and the horror anthology Joko Anwar’s Nightmares and Daydreams . Popular Video Trends and the Creator Economy

Indonesia’s digital entertainment is defined by a "mobile-first intensity," where 86% of the population accesses content via smartphones.

Short-Form Video & Live Commerce: Platforms like TikTok (now merged with Tokopedia) have revolutionized how Indonesians consume videos. Live shopping has evolved into a major entertainment channel, blending product reviews with high-energy performances.

Viral Music & Identity: There is a significant trend of Eastern Indonesian music (from Papua and Maluku) going viral on YouTube and TikTok, allowing regional artists to achieve national and even global visibility.

Content Niches: Popular genres on YouTube Trending include vlogs, skits/parodies, food reviews, and nostalgic remixes of 70s and 80s Indonesian culture. Future Outlook

By late 2026, the industry is expected to see a greater emphasis on IP-based loyalty and multi-revenue assets, such as turning popular films into gaming or web-based franchises. While the animation industry remains expensive, it is being positioned as a key pillar for the future creative economy, with titles like Garuda: Dare to Dream pushing technical boundaries. Indonesia is currently the fastest-growing film market in Southeast Asia, with local productions capturing a massive 65-67% of the domestic box office share. The Rise of Indonesian Cinema

Indonesian films are no longer just domestic hits; they are achieving unprecedented international acclaim and commercial scale.

Theatrical Dominance: Cinema admissions are projected to reach 100 million by the end of 2026. Major releases like Joko Anwar’s Ghost in the Cell (2026) are scheduled for screening in 86 countries.

Film Festivals: High-profile titles like Wregas Bhanuteja’s Levitating (Sundance 2026) and Edwin’s Sleep No More (Berlin 2026) continue to represent Indonesia on the global circuit.

Economic Shift: The industry is moving from "volume" to "quality," with films increasingly designed as multi-revenue assets through strategic brand partnerships and IP-based loyalty. Popular Video Streaming Platforms

As of early 2026, the streaming market has reached a milestone where Indonesian productions equal Korean programming in viewership share (30% each).

Indonesian entertainment and popular video cannot be understood through Western models of "creative industries." It is not about intellectual property or high production value. It is about affective density—the ability to trigger gemes (cute aggression), baper (bringing feelings into everything), or merinding (goosebumps from horror) within 15 seconds.

The future will see a convergence: Vidio will adopt TikTok’s vertical UI; TikTok will fund 30-minute sinetron; and AI-dubbed K-dramas will increasingly lose to local "folk horror" shot on iPhones in a kost (boarding house). The deep structure of Indonesian video is gotong royong 2.0—not collective physical labor, but collective algorithmic participation, where every like, sawer, and share is a vote for a hyper-local, morally conservative, emotionally maximalist vision of the nation.
